Playa de Las Minas is located on the Mediterranean Sea and it is in the 68th place out of 141 beaches in the Murcia region 56.1 km away from its center, the city of Murcia. It is one of the beaches of Canada de Gallego settlement, just 2.9 km from its center. The beach is located in a natural place, surrounded by the cliffs.
It is a small bay with turquoise water and bright sand, so you don't need special shoes. The entrance to the water is very smooth. This beach is suitable for different categories of people, lonely travellers, relaxation getaway lovers etc. It is almost deserted place even during the high season.
Playa de Las Minas coast is free for all. It has no amenities, only nature. .
In addition to swimming and sunbathing, you can also take part in other activities.
This beach is easily accessible, it is located very close to road. Parking is located at some distance, within 300 meters.

The coastline of Playa de Las Minas is covered with golden sand. It's very clean, the surface is pure and unmixed. The water is impeccably turquoise. The entrance to the water is sandy, which makes it very comfortable.
For the main activity - sunbathing, there are no sun loungers on the Playa de Las Minas, so you need to take personal items with you and there is no natural shade, so be careful on a hot day.
The entrance to the water is very smooth, the bottom is comfortable. The prevalence of sharks in the area is low.
Playa de Las Minas does not have a wave-protected swimming area, but there are usually no strong waves during the season.
So the overall recommendation of the Playa de Las Minas for swimming is positive.
Family travelers should consider the following features of the beach. This is the natural virgin beach with minimal amenities. It's covered with sand and the entrance to the water is very smooth.
The beach is located in a natural area. In the high season, there are still almost no visitors, which makes this place ideal for a secluded holiday.

The month with the highest temperature in Playa de Las Minas is August. Its average value reaches 31°C. The warmest sea is in August, the average value is 26°C. The coldest month is January with air temperature 15°C and water 15°C. See more details in weather section.
